Output ec0a90cb824fb90789bcb483969a09ef3f959ebb7453c124a846607dfe6d2826:39

value
3395539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6843e480450b28e656273df49eedb1d82609d860 OP_EQUAL
address
3BCKXkeo1gwnF4xGU3UT28rPLrdh7iBdgs
transaction
ec0a90cb824fb90789bcb483969a09ef3f959ebb7453c124a846607dfe6d2826
spent
true